Answer:
The total distance that Jason run is given by relation t = [tex]\dfrac{23 n}{4}[/tex] miles .
Step-by-step explanation:
Given as :
Jason runs the same distance each day.
The distance cover by Jason on 7 days = 40 [tex]\dfrac{1}{4}[/tex] = [tex]\dfrac{161}{4}[/tex] miles
Let The number of days = n days
And The total distance = t miles
Now, According to question
Applying unitary method
∵ The distance cover by Jason in 7 days = [tex]\dfrac{161}{4}[/tex] miles
Or,The distance cover by Jason in 1 day = [tex]\frac{\frac{161}{4}}{7}[/tex] miles
∴ The distance cover by Jason in n day = [tex]\frac{\frac{161}{4}}{7}[/tex] × n
I.e t = [tex]\dfrac{161 n}{28}[/tex] miles
Or, t = [tex]\dfrac{23 n}{4}[/tex] miles
Hence, The total distance that Jason run is given by relation t = [tex]\dfrac{23 n}{4}[/tex] miles . Answer
